**The opportunity**
We are seeking an experienced and visionary Data Architect to lead the definition and execution of data governance and data architecture strategies that support our transition from an Engineer-to-Order (ETO) to a Configure-to-Order (CETO) delivery model.


This role will play a pivotal part in ensuring that data across product, project, and enterprise systems is structured, governed, and utilized to enable modularization, reusability, and scalability of HVDC solutions. You will be a key driver in promoting organizational understanding of data as a strategic asset, fostering alignment across business, IT, and engineering domains.


**How You’ll Make An Impact**

- Define and implement the data governance framework to ensure accuracy, consistency, and traceability of product and project data throughout the value chain.
- Design and maintain data models and architectures that enable integration across PLM, ERP, BIM, and other enterprise systems.
- Collaborate closely with PLM architects, product managers, and IT teams to ensure alignment between data architecture and PLM strategy.
- Drive stakeholder engagement and data literacy initiatives to elevate organizational understanding of data ownership, lineage, and governance.
- Support the transition from ETO to CETO by establishing data foundations for modularity, configurability, and reuse.
- Identify and mitigate data quality risks through proactive governance and cross-functional collaboration.
- Define KPIs and metrics to monitor data integrity, governance maturity, and business impact.
- Contribute to the development of enterprise-wide data catalogues, taxonomies, and master data management principles

Hitachi Energy is a global technology leader in electrification, powering a sustainable energy future through innovative power grid technologies with digital at the core. Over three billion people depend on our technologies to power their daily lives.


With over a century in pioneering mission-critical technologies like high-voltage, transformers, automation, and power electronics, we are addressing the most urgent energy challenge of our time – balancing soaring electricity demand, while decarbonizing the power system.
